Whole heartedly agree.
If you look at Dollar Shave Club, Warby Parker, Purple Mattress, Bonobos, etc, etc..they basically just picked one specific area and streamlined the product ecosystem in their offering. Yes, midscale men's clothing and eyewear need more options than a razor category. Nonetheless, they took a vulture approach to the huge monolith. It's going to keep happening. Every large consumer name will die death of thousand cuts on a similar model.

I have a question for experienced enrepreneurs.
Let´s say you have some online bussiness idea. And you need to involve other people like coders or some smaller investor. How do you ensure yourself, that they won´t steal you the idea? I am talking about building online stuff, that means they probably live on the other side of the world and you never meet them.

Where you source from, and indeed where you sell to, is an important business decision. You are asking how to have your cake and eat it to. You cannot generally do this. You can pay for non-critical work to be done cheaply by Eastern European/Indian/etc, who NDAs and non-competes will be worthless with, or you can hire someone from your own jurisdiction with whom those documents will hold up.
